Gunmen kill Two, others injured in Kaduna community

January 13, 2021
in News
Kindly share this post

Unknown gunmen have ambushed and killed two locals between Bakin Kogi and Narido village in Kauru Local Government area of Kaduna State.

Troops of Operation Safe Haven, informed the Kaduna State Government of the attack on Tuesday.

The state Commissioner, Internal Security and Home Affairs, Samuel Aruwan, explained that the troops responded to a distress call and arrived at the location to find two persons – Musa Garba and Yakubu Yawo – shot dead.

The statement further explained that two others – Monday Joseph and Jacob Thomas – sustained gunshot injuries.

The statement said that the victims were ambushed by unknown gunmen between Bakin Kogi and Narido village, as they made their way from Bakin Kogi Market.

Governor Nasir El-Rufai expressed concern at the report of the attack, and sent condolences to the families of the bereaved.

He prayed for the repose of the victims’ souls and quick recovery of the injured.

Governor El-Rufai enjoined security agencies to ensure a detailed investigation into the incident.

The injured victims have been taken to hospital for treatment, and troops are in the area to ensure the restoration of normalcy.
